    Evaluation of e-learning web sites using fuzzy axiomatic design based approach

    Get PDF
    High quality web site has been generally recognized as a critical enabler to conduct online business. Numerous studies exist in the literature to measure the business performance in relation to web site quality. In this paper, an axiomatic design based approach for fuzzy group decision making is adopted to evaluate the quality of e-learning web sites. Another multi-criteria decision making technique, namely fuzzy TOPSIS, is applied in order to validate the outcome. The methodology proposed in this paper has the advantage of incorporating requirements and enabling reductions in the problem size, as compared to fuzzy TOPSIS. A case study focusing on Turkish e-learning websites is presented, and based on the empirical findings, managerial implications and recommendations for future research are offered

    Quality management maturity: Its application and evaluation in Chinese private equipment manufacturing enterprises

    Get PDF
    Although China’s private equipment manufacturing enterprises have made significant progress, quality problems still occur because of the weak quality foundation. Therefore, it is necessary to scientifically evaluate the quality management of equipment manufacturing enterprises, identify the deficiencies and defects of quality management, and provide systematic and targeted countermeasures and suggestions. The thesis conducted text analysis on the quality award self-assessment materials of three companies and constructed an evaluation model for private equipment manufacturing enterprises including four sub-systems (management process, support process, customeroriented process and result) through three-level coding. Meanwhile, in order to empirically test the quality management maturity evaluation model of private equipment enterprises and explore the relationships between the sub-systems, the thesis selected 6 private equipment enterprises located in Guizhou province as the pre-survey objects and selected 80 private manufacturing enterprises located in Beijing, Zhejiang province, Guizhou province, Hunan province, and Sichuan province as the formal survey objects to carry out hypothesis test. Moreover, the thesis developed a maturity evaluation scale. Applying the scale to the case GXTF company, the thesis proposed improvement strategies for GXTF company. In theory, the thesis enriched the research on the quality management of private equipment manufacturing enterprises.     ERP implementation methodologies and frameworks: a literature review

    Get PDF
    Enterprise Resource Planning (ERP) implementation is a complex and vibrant process, one that involves a combination of technological and organizational interactions. Often an ERP implementation project is the single largest IT project that an organization has ever launched and requires a mutual fit of system and organization. Also the concept of an ERP implementation supporting business processes across many different departments is not a generic, rigid and uniform concept and depends on variety of factors. As a result, the issues addressing the ERP implementation process have been one of the major concerns in industry. Therefore ERP implementation receives attention from practitioners and scholars and both, business as well as academic literature is abundant and not always very conclusive or coherent. However, research on ERP systems so far has been mainly focused on diffusion, use and impact issues. Less attention has been given to the methods used during the configuration and the implementation of ERP systems, even though they are commonly used in practice, they still remain largely unexplored and undocumented in Information Systems research. So, the academic relevance of this research is the contribution to the existing body of scientific knowledge. An annotated brief literature review is done in order to evaluate the current state of the existing academic literature. The purpose is to present a systematic overview of relevant ERP implementation methodologies and frameworks as a desire for achieving a better taxonomy of ERP implementation methodologies. This paper is useful to researchers who are interested in ERP implementation methodologies and frameworks. Results will serve as an input for a classification of the existing ERP implementation methodologies and frameworks. Also, this paper aims also at the professional ERP community involved in the process of ERP implementation by promoting a better understanding of ERP implementation methodologies and frameworks, its variety and history

    Performance Evaluation of Port Enterprise Resource Integration Based on Fuzzy Comprehensive Evaluation Method

    Get PDF
    With increasingly mature global supply chain network with ports as the core, competition among ports has gradually turned to the ability and efficiency of resource integration. However, there is a lack of relevant studies on how to scientifically evaluate the resource integration performance of port enterprises. To comprehensively evaluate the actual effect of port enterprises in process of resource integration, a performance evaluation system of port enterprises resource integration covering 19 secondary indicators from the four dimensions of financial integration, operational efficiency, technological innovation, and realized benefit was built, fuzzy analytic hierarchy process (FAHP) was used to determine weights of various indicators and port enterprises in Zhejiang, Jiangsu, Liaoning, Shandong and Guangdong provinces of China were taken as samples, and fuzzy comprehensive evaluation (FCE) was used to evaluate its resource integration performance. Results show that technological innovation is the primary performance indicator, followed by financial integration indicators, and the impact of realization efficiency and operational efficiency indicators is relatively weak. Resource integration performances of port enterprises in Zhejiang, Jiangsu, Liaoning, Shandong, and Guangdong are generally good. Evaluation results of sample ports reflect the actual integration of ports, and the model can effectively evaluate the performance of port enterprise resource integration. Conclusions obtained from this study provide theoretical support for the scientific performance evaluation of port enterprise resource integration

    Performance Evaluation of Port Logistics Informatization Construction: A Case Study from China

    Get PDF
    Global economic integration has accelerated frequency of trade between different countries and promoted logistics industry to quickly become another development highland. Facts have proved that logistics has been separated from production and circulation as an independent link, driven by existing technology and demand, and with its characteristics and needs of the times, logistics has formed a strong professional field. At the same time, it can also independently undertake corresponding brokerage business activities in trade exchanges. To better understand the role of port and logistics in trade, it is particularly necessary to study port logistics informatization. Considering efficiency of input and output, more attention should be paid to performance evaluation of port logistics informatization construction. Based on analysis of port logistics informatization development, evaluation index system and DEA evaluation model which can represent performance of port logistics informatization were constructed. 17 listed ports in China were taken as examples for empirical study, and suggestions for development of port logistics informatization are put forward. Results show that among 17 ports, only Tangshan port, Shenzhen port, Yantian port and Chongqing port have a technical efficiency value of 1, while the other 13 ports have a certain degree of redundancy in technical efficiency value of information input, indicating that development and construction of port logistics informatization has a very important impact on port logistics income. Efficiency value of average annual net profit indicates that the port has redundant investment in information construction, which means that construction of port logistics informatization can not only blindly pay attention to informatization input, and that shortage of informatization output will be affected by other factors to a certain extent. The more investment in informatization construction is not the better, and different ports are affected by different types of factors. Therefore, it is necessary to combine actual development status of ports and to apply right medicine to avoid insufficiency or redundancy of port input, to realize optimal investment strategy for informatization construction of port logistics. Through this study, it is expected to achieve the purpose of systematically sorting out, concluding and expanding relevant theories of port logistics informatization construction, clarifying management problems that need to be solved, indicating methods for promotion of informatization construction, and providing new ideas and reference basis for reform, transformation and upgrading of port enterprises

    SYSTEM OF METHODICAL APPROACHES AND METHODS OF COMPLEX MARKETING RESEARCHES IN FOOD ENTERPRISES

    Get PDF
    The methodology for assessing the quality of public service at catering firms should be based on a comparison of consumer expectations and perceptions in relation to the service process, that is, the quality coefficient is determined as the difference between perception and expectations. In this case, the quality factor can be determined both by the indicator of interest and by the enterprise as a whole. Consequently, the criteria for assessing the quality of public service at catering establishments must be formed taking into account its type and class. To obtain primary information from consumers, it is necessary to organize and conduct a sociological study. When choosing a method of sociological research, it is advisable to give preference to interviews, since this is a rather flexible method of collecting information, based on direct contact between the interviewer and the respondent. The main advantage of the interview, in comparison with the questionnaire, is the ability to control the perception and understanding of the questions by the respondent; if necessary, the interviewer can explain the questions asked, and also clarify the respondent's point of view with the help of additional questions.When conducting a sociological research by the interview method, the requirements for the formation of a questionnaire are significantly reduced. The list of questions asked to respondents should be expanded with personal questions, the purpose of which is to reflect: age, social status, average monthly income.     A Multi-factor Customer Classification Evaluation Model

    Get PDF
    Pervasive application of data mining technology is very important in analytical CRM software development when the distributed data warehouse is constructed. We propose a multi-factor customer classification evaluation model CLV/CL/CC which comprehensively considers customer lifetime value, customer loyalty and customer credit. It classifies clients with synthetic data mining algorithms. In this paper, we present an extended Bayes model which substitutes the primary attribute group with a new attribute group to improve the classification quality of naive Bayes
